What Country Does Easter Island Belong To? Easter Island, Spanish Isla de Pascua, also called Rapa Nui, Chilean dependency in the eastern Pacific Ocean. It is the easternmost outpost of the Polynesian island world. It is famous for its giant stone statues. What country currently owns Easter Island? Easter Island Rapa Nui Isla de Pascua
